1. Less isolation, more face time
Read Full Articlehttps://www.aventr.com/blog/5-ways-better-engage-employees
“70% of employees who lacked confidence in senior leadership were not fully engaged in their role.”
Read Full Articlehttps://www.aventr.com/blog/5-ways-better-engage-employees
Increasing face time and even simple interaction with all your employees will go a long way to restoring trust
and understanding.

4. Facilitate friendships at work
Read Full Articlehttps://www.aventr.com/blog/5-ways-better-engage-employees
Employees with a best friend at work are 7x more likely to be fully engaged.
Read Full Articlehttps://www.aventr.com/blog/5-ways-better-engage-employees
Activities that bring people together, including game nights, happy hours, bowling leagues, book clubs and idea incubators go a long way towards building connections.
